New Showbiz Analysis

The film’s strongest asset is its gender representation: women healthcare workers lead the response, making critical decisions under extreme pressure. Their leadership is portrayed as competent and courageous, avoiding tokenism. Racial and ethnic diversity is high by virtue of an all-South Asian cast rooted in Mumbai’s reality. Characters of color are not peripheral; they are the backbone of the narrative. However, LGBTQ+ representation is entirely absent, and disability is reduced to generic medical need. The cultural framing leans heavily on patriotism, which narrows the emotional and social scope.

Category Breakdown

Does Bharat Bhhagya Viddhaata have LGBTQ+ representation?

Minimal

No LGBTQ+ characters appear or are identified. The narrative concentrates on hospital staff and patients during the 2008 Mumbai attacks, leaving queer identities absent from the story.

How does Bharat Bhhagya Viddhaata portray gender?

Excellent

Women drive the narrative as nurses and healthcare workers who save lives under fire. Their bravery and decision-making during the crisis are foregrounded, positioning them as central leaders rather than background figures.

How racially and ethnically diverse is Bharat Bhhagya Viddhaata?

Excellent

The cast is entirely South Asian, mirroring the Mumbai setting and the real-life events depicted. Characters of color occupy central, powerful roles throughout the unfolding hospital siege.

How does Bharat Bhhagya Viddhaata represent religion and culture?

Limited

The film honors Indian patriotism and the courage of local healthcare workers during a national tragedy. It frames their service as heroic and essential, though the cultural lens remains narrowly patriotic.

Does Bharat Bhhagya Viddhaata include disability representation?

Minimal

Patients requiring medical care appear, but none are described as having disabilities. The focus stays on staff actions rather than exploring patient identities or lived experiences of disability.

Official Synopsis

Inside Cama Hospital, one of the sites targeted during the 2008 Mumbai terror attacks, nurses, ward boys, cleaners, lift operators, security personnel, and administrative workers keep 400 people alive while armed assailants struck the city around them.
